About Our Client

Our client is the world leading manufacturer of wood panel boards. They pride themselves on delivering “Wood Perfected” and have invested in innovation since 1897 with £300m being spent on their Chirk manufacturing facility within the last few years, and a further £200m to be spent in the next couple of years.

As the world leader in the manufacturing of wood-based panel products, they are seeking a loyal, ambitious and passionate Trainee and Skilled Production Operators who can add real value to their teams.
